Hi
try
SUMPRODUCT. e.g.
=SUMPRODUCT(--(BA23:BA500="y"),(BB23:BB500=1),N23:N500)

-----Original Message-----
I'm currently summing a column of numbers using the
following formula:
=sumif(BA23:BA500,"y",N23:N500)

I would now like to break down the sum based on a second
condition ie. only sum the column cells where the above

is
true and where the value of the cells in another column
equals 0 or 1 or 2 etc.
What I'm trying to do is derive subtotals of the sum

above
based on the revision level where the BA cells are set
to "y". Does anyone have a suggestion?
